1. A wiper blade for clearing a surface, comprising an elongated wiper body having a base side and a face side and said face side having side edges, a pair of opposing blades which extend substantially parallel with each other and along the length of said body, one of said opposing blades being connected to each of said side edges and extending away from said face side, said body further including means on said base side for attachment of said wiper blade to a supporting wiper arm, said wiper blade further comprising a center rib which is connected to said body between said opposing blades and said side edges, said center rib being shorter than said opposing blades and out of contact with the surface during operation, said opposing blades flexing when the wiper blade is moved across the surface and one of said blades flexing into engagement with said center rib at a level which is displaced from said surface, and each of said opposing blades having a wiping piece formed thereon and extending along the length thereof, said wiping piece of each blade being located to contact said surface when the wiper blade is moved across the surface.
